new sellers text

Up for sale is a 1970 Plymouth sport fury 2 dr coupe. It has 83310 original miles. One owner Very minor rust.
This vehicle has been parked inside in dry storage since the 80's. Original 383ci 2v engine been converted to 4v in the 1970's.
We have the original 2v intake & carburetor.
Due to extended storage, this vehicle is listed as NOT RUNNING.
$12000.00.

PH29:
Plymouth Fury
High
2 Door Sports Hardtop

L0D: 383 290HP 1-2BBL 8 CYL
1970
Belvidere, IL, USA

243763: Sequence number

E61: 383 cid 2 barrel V8 290hp
D32: Heavy Duty Automatic Transmission
FY4: Light Gold Poly Exterior Color
H6XA: Trim - High, Vinyl Bucket Seats, Charcoal/Black
TX9: Black Int. Door Frames
423: Build Date: April 23
284259: Order number

V1Y: Full Vinyl Top, Gold
A01: Light Package
B41: Front Disc Brakes w/Standard 10in RR Drum
C16: Console w/Woodgrain Panel
C55: Bucket Seats
G11: Tinted Glass (all)

H51: Air Conditioning with Heater
L31: Hood/Fender Mounted Turn Signals
M25: Wide sill moldings
M31: Belt Moldings
M85: Front & Rear Bumper Guards
R22: AM Radio with 8 Track (10 Watts)

???: Unknown
V5X: Body Side Stripes, Black
Y05: Build to USA Specs
Y14: Sold Car
26: 26in Radiator
